【javascript – 使用ReactJS自动完成属性】教程文章相关的互联网学习教程文章

javascript – React – 按对象属性过滤【代码】

我试图按属性过滤对象,但我无法使其工作. 对象中的数据结构如下:我通过UID获取数据,然后映射该对象的所有项目,但我无法使过滤器工作. 渲染方法如下所示:render() {return(<div>{Object.keys(this.state.dataGoal).filter(key => key.main == true).map( (key, index) => {return <div key={key}><h1>{this.state.dataGoal[key].name}</h1><p>{this.state.dataGoal[key].main}</p></div>})}</div> 我有什么想法我做错了吗? 谢谢你...

javascript – 未捕获的TypeError:无法读取reactjs中未定义的属性’func’【代码】

我在浏览器控制台中收到错误Uncaught TypeError: Cannot read property 'func' of undefined在下一行(在捆绑的js文件中)ChannelForm.propTypes = {addChannel: _react2['default'].PropTypes.func.isRequired };我的代码看起来像这样我得到这个错误ChannelForm.propTypes={addChannel: React.PropTypes.func.isRequired }一切似乎都很好.我无法弄清楚这里有什么问题.解决方法:React.PropTypes不再有效.根据react docs,React.PropT...

React 学习笔记 —— refs 属性【代码】

字符串 ref 注意:过度使用字符串ref 会存在效率问题,该方式可能会在未来的版本中移除 class Demo extends React.Component {handleChange = () => {// 可以通过 refs 访问到被引用的标签this.refs.p.innerText = this.refs.input.value}render () {return (<div>// 通过 ref 对标签进行引用<input ref="input" type="text" onChange={this.handleChange}/><p ref="p"></p></div>)} }ReactDOM.render(<Demo />, document.getEleme...

React —— 组件实例的三大核心属性 state,props,refs【代码】

React —— 组件实例的三大核心属性 state,props,refs React —— 组件实例的三大核心属性 state,props,refs一、statestate 介绍state 初始化1.借助类的构造器对state进行初始化2.简写正确地使用 state1. 不要直接修改 State2. State 的更新可能是异步的3. State 的更新会被合并,而不是覆盖实例 二、propsprops 介绍props 基本使用1.在组件中通过属性传入2.利用扩展运算符的简写3.在组件类定义中通过 this.props 读出props 限...